Description: MegaToBox is a cloud storage and file hosting service that emphasizes security and privacy. It offers end-to-end encryption and allows users to control encryption keys. The free plan includes 20GB of storage.

Description: Resilio Sync is a fast, reliable, and secure file synchronization application. It uses P2P technology to sync files between devices without relying on a central cloud storage provider. Works across Windows, Mac, Linux, Android, iOS.

Pros & Cons Analysis

MegaToBox
MegaToBox
Pros
  • Strong security and privacy
  • User control over encryption
  • Easy to use interface
  • Good free plan
  • File versioning
  • Desktop and mobile access
Cons
  • Paid plans can be expensive
  • No offline access for free users
  • Limited integrations with other services
Resilio Sync
Resilio Sync
Pros
  • Fast sync speeds
  • No limit on sync size or bandwidth
  • Works offline and across different platforms
  • Secure encrypted transfers
  • Easy to set up and use
Cons
  • Must keep devices online to sync
  • No web interface
  • Limited mobile app features
  • No cloud storage integration
